Using the method of the tensor Green's function of the wave equation, the conditions have been determined under which the dipole approximation is sufficient in the problem of the scattering of surface optical electromagnetic waves (surface plasmon polaritons) on a small spherical particle. The independence of the electric field inside the scatterer of the spatial coordinates is used as the main requirement of the dipole approximation. Conditions are obtained in the form of inequalities involving the wavenumber, the material parameters of the system, and the size of the scatterer and its position with respect to the surface on which plasmon polaritons are excited.
